Favorite Birding Spot: Much like migrating birds, Jasper likes to travel to different regions for his birding expositions. His region of choice depends heavily on season and climate, but ultimately comes down to his own personal preference. Currently, Jasper enjoys coastlines of both common and uncommon islands, such as Tasmania.
The isolation of Tasmania means that several species have evolved separately from their mainland counterparts into separate species with unique colourations and behaviours. 12 endemic bird species, 14 including the migratory parrots which breed only in Tasmania, and several subspecies are among over 230 species which have been recorded in the state.
